Tressel was one of six active football coaches who took part in the second Coaches Tour to the Middle East.
The tour launched from McConnell Air Force Base, near Wichita, Kan., the home of the 22nd Aerial Refueling Wing. The coaches visited U.S. military installations in Germany, Turkey, Iraq, Kuwait, Djibouti and Spain.

The photographs taken during the trip showed Tressel meeting with U.S. servicemen and women and even playing football with the troops.
One of the video clips taken showed Tressel chest-bumping a serviceman who made a good play.
Tressel said that he spent one night in a bunk bed inside one of Saddam Hussein's palaces.
The other coaches on the trip were Texas' Mack Brown, Air Force's Troy Calhoun, Wake Forest's Jim Grobe, UCLA's Rick Neuheisel and Mississippi's Houston Nutt. Former Auburn coach Tommy Tuberville also took part.
